Driving program menu page

On this menu page, you can edit the ”driving programs”. Each ”driving program” contains

the control mode (contouring error, speed, torque or position control), setpoint, different

ramps, acceleration values and specific waiting times.

During the first commissioning, the drive traverses in the ”Following error” mode. Select

drivingprogram”1”inthe”Currentdrivingprogram”field.Drivingprogram”0”hasspecial

properties which will not be described in detail here ( Software Manual).
Select ”Following error” as control mode and ”positive” setpoint processing. The time

selected under the menu item ”Set value positive/negative” indicates the following error

mode time. Do not change the entry ”0”. With this setting, the drive will continue

operation until a ”stop” command will be sent.
